One problem we had is that source writing in shutdown (and I think startup, 
too) was not working, due to the strange InMidstOfFileinNotification, uh, trick.
(abusing an exception to emulate a kind of dynamic variable).

This now has been replace by having a #deferFlushDuring:  on SourceFiles and 
using that for MC loading.

I think this might fix the problem.

Hi guys,

It seems there is a strange interaction between the deprecation 
rewriter and image startup.


If you load a package that has deprecated calls (command line loading: 
without GUI), then save the image, the image will appear locked on the 
next interactive start (black background on Linux).


Loading the package by hand in an interactive image and saving a new 
version with the deprecation rewritten solves the problem.
